About Kabuliwala

Kabuliwala is a highly-regarded Afghan restaurant situated in Batley, offering an authentic culinary journey for diners in Yorkshire. With an impressive Google rating of 4.7 out of 5 stars from over 150 reviews, it's clear this establishment has captured the hearts and taste buds of its patrons. Recently relocated to a larger venue, Kabuliwala provides a beautiful, peaceful, and calming atmosphere that guests praise from the moment they step inside.

The restaurant is celebrated for its rich flavours and speciality dishes, including the acclaimed Dumpukht and succulent kebabs. Reviewers consistently highlight the genuine "food sense" and authentic experience, making it a must-visit for lovers of Desi cuisine. Whether you're seeking a family dinner or an adventurous meal, the dedicated team at Kabuliwala strives to provide memorable dining experiences focused on traditional recipes and warm hospitality.

Visiting Information

Kabuliwala is open Tuesday to Sunday from 4:00 PM to 11:00 PM, remaining closed on Mondays. Specific accessibility features and payment options were not provided in the available business data. Kabuliwala has now relocated to a bigger and better venue compared to their previous Bradford Road site. I visited on the second day of their opening. Unfortunately, there wasn’t much of a warm welcome when we arrived - instead, the staff stared at us and stood in the entrance, blocking our way. I had to ask if they were open to break the ice. Hopefully, this was just down to new staff still settling in, as a bit of hospitality training would make a big difference. Minor teething issues like this are expected early on and will hopefully be resolved soon. We were then offered the choice between dining at a table or in one of the private booths. We opted for a booth for comfort and privacy. Only two booths were in use, with the third being used as a prayer space which was good to see. The booths were clean and tidy, though the 6000K bright white lighting was a bit harsh and took away from the ambience. Some warmer lighting would really help set the mood. There was also no background music, which made the restaurant feel rather quiet. Adding some soft background audio would really improve the atmosphere. That said, the overall aesthetics were clean and welcoming. The menu offers a good variety of dishes. Our food arrived in around 30 minutes. There was a small mix-up with our order, but it was quickly resolved without any fuss - great customer service there, and they definitely redeemed themselves. The food itself was excellent, just as expected. The rice was perfectly cooked, and the chicken sheesh was tasty. The chapli kebabs were a bit smaller than what nearby competitors serve, but arguably better in flavour. Overall, a good experience and I’d definitely visit again. HMC approved. Card payments accepted. On-street parking available nearby.
